Veronika Andreyevna Andrusenko (néePopova) (Russian:Вероника Андреевна Андрусенко (Попова); born 20 January 1991) is a Russian competitiveswimmer.[1]
At the2012 Summer Olympics, she competed for the national team in theWomen's 4 × 100 metre freestyle relay, finishing in 10th place in the heats, failing to reach the final. She also took part in the 100 m freestyle (finishing in 17th), the 200 m freestyle (finishing in 6th place),4 × 200 m freestyle (finishing in 15th) and the4 × 100 m medley relay (finishing in 4th).[2]
At the 2016 Summer Olympics, she competed in the same events, finishing in 19th in the 100 m freestyle, 9th in the 200 m freestyle, 10th in the4 × 100 m freestyle, 7th in the4 × 200 m freestyle and 6th in the4 × 100 m medley relay.[2]
In 2019 she was a member[3] of the2019 International Swimming League representingTeam Iron.[citation needed]
She is married toVyacheslav Andrusenko, who is also a swimmer for Russia.[2]
